The Kracher Welschriesling Trockenbeerenauslese No. 7 from 2012 is a world-class sweet wine from Austria’s Burgenland region. It shines in the glass with a bold golden hue. The nose offers layers of ripe stone fruits like peach and apricot, wrapped in fine honey aromas and subtle herbal notes. On the palate, it delivers a luxurious sweetness balanced by vibrant acidity, tropical fruit nuances, and a long, mineral-laced finish.
